At a glance

Kaiser Foundation Hospital - Orange County - Anaheim carries a 4-star CMS overall rating — above the national norm. On healthcare-associated infection measures, it performs better than the national average on 6 and worse on 0.

Frequently asked questions

How is Kaiser Foundation Hospital - Orange County - Anaheim rated?
Kaiser Foundation Hospital - Orange County - Anaheim has a 4 out of 5 CMS overall star rating as of the latest CMS release.
Does Kaiser Foundation Hospital - Orange County - Anaheim have emergency services?
Yes. Kaiser Foundation Hospital - Orange County - Anaheim operates a 24/7 emergency department.
Where is Kaiser Foundation Hospital - Orange County - Anaheim located?
Kaiser Foundation Hospital - Orange County - Anaheim is located at 3440 E la Palma Ave, Anaheim, CA 92806.
What type of hospital is Kaiser Foundation Hospital - Orange County - Anaheim?
Kaiser Foundation Hospital - Orange County - Anaheim is classified by CMS as a Acute Care Hospitals facility (Voluntary non-profit - Private).
